| 0:23.6 | Today I'm reading Psalm 35. It's a Psalm of David in the World English Bible and this is what it says. |
| 0:31.6 | Contend Yahweh with those who contend with me. |
| 0:34.6 | Fight against those who fight against me take hold of |
| 0:38.1 | shield and buckler and stand up for my help brandish the spear and block |
| 0:44.1 | those who pursue me tell my soul I am your salvation let those who seek |
| 0:50.4 | after my soul be disappointed and brought to dishonor let those who plot my ruin be turned back and confounded. |
| 0:58.0 | Let them be as chafe before the wind, Yahweh's angel driving them on. |
| 1:03.0 | Let their way be dark and slippery Yahweh's angel pursuing them. |
| 1:07.0 | For without cause they have hidden their net in a pit for me without cause they have dug a pit for my soul let destruction come on him unawares let his net that he is hidden catch himself let him fall into that destruction my soul shall be joyful in yahway it shall rejoice in his salvation. All my bones shall say, |
| 1:30.1 | Yahweh, who is like you, who delivers the poor from him who is too strong for him? Yes, the |
| 1:35.9 | poor and the needy from him who robs him. Unrighteous witnesses rise up. They ask me about things |
| 1:43.1 | that I don't know about. They reward me evil for good to the bereaving of my soul. But as for me, when they were sick, my clothing was sackcloth. I afflicted my soul with fasting. My prayer returned into my own bosom. I behaved myself as though it had been my friend or my brother. I bowed down mourning as one who mourns his mother. But in my adversity, they rejoiced and gathered themselves together. The attackers gathered themselves together against me, and I didn't know it. They tore at me and didn't cease. Like the profane mockers |
| 2:19.5 | and feasts, they gnashed their teeth at me. Lord, how long will you look on? Rescue my soul from |
| 2:26.5 | their destruction, my precious life from the lions. I will give you thanks in the great assembly. |
| 2:32.8 | I will praise you among many people. Don't let those who are my |
| 2:36.6 | enemies wrongfully rejoice over me. Neither let those who hate me without a cause wink their eyes. |
| 2:43.5 | For they don't speak peace, but they devise deceitful words against those who are quiet in the land. |
| 2:49.8 | Yes, they opened their mouth wide against me. |
